Looking at your BBS stats, it shows you do not have a data connection 50% of the time. Are you turning your mobile data connection off or are you in an area where you have zero mobile data connection? Also, are your Google Play Services up to date? The reason I ask is because the com.google.android.gms alarm woke your device 1003 times at a rate of 1.2 per minute.

Are you in LTE coverage or only 4G/H+?
If you're in LTE, try disabling it and going with only 4G. If LTE coverage is low, then it could be the source for your drain.
Alternatively, if you're in WiFi zones regularly, use Tasker to disable mobile data all together (or 2G at the most) while connected to WiFi and then invert the same task to re-enable mobile data when you're out of WiFi range.

8 hours of SOT is really good. You can try installing Wakelock Detector to get a different perspective. Also, anything that uses accessibility services may harm battery life. Another thing you can do is go to settings-permissions-autolaunch and disable autolaunching of apps that don't need to be running all the time. You can see what apps are currently running in settings - app management. One last thing is that your signal strength isn't that great, so it may just be how it's supposed to be.
